Sep 12, 2023 · The Lewis structure of carbonate [CO3]2- ion is made up of a carbon (C) atom and three oxygen (O) atoms. The carbon (C) is present at the center of the molecular ion while oxygen (O) occupies the terminals, one on each side. There are a total of 3 electron density regions around the central C atom in the Lewis structure of [CO3]2-. Let calculate the total valence electrons present on CO32 ... The structure on the right is the Lewis electron structure, or Lewis structure, for H 2 O. With two bonding pairs and two lone pairs, the oxygen atom has now completed its octet. Moreover, by sharing a bonding pair with oxygen, each hydrogen atom now has a full valence shell of two electrons. Note that the + sign in the Lewis structure for H3O+ means that we have lost a valence electron. Therefore we only have 8 valence electrons for the H3O+ Lewis structure. H3O+ is an important compound in Acid-Base chemistry and is considered an acid.
